About Brooks Rehabilitation: For over five decades, Brooks Rehabilitation has been at the forefront of physical rehabilitation care. The nonprofit, based in Florida, is recognized as the premier rehabilitation system and ranks among the top 20 nationally according to U.S. News & World Report. Brooks currently manages three inpatient hospitals in Florida and is set to expand its reach through a collaboration with Mayo Clinic, opening a new facility on Mayo's Phoenix campus in 2026. The organization's commitment to advancing rehabilitation science is evident in its focus on innovative research, education, and cutting-edge technology. Offering a comprehensive system of care, Brooks provides inpatient and outpatient services, skilled nursing, assisted living, and memory care and impacts lives beyond clinical settings through community programs designed to enhance the quality of life for individuals with physical disabilities. Location Overview: This position is located at our University Crossing location, Joint Commission certified, three-story, 82,000 square-foot facility with 111 beds, serving patients with both short and long-term rehabilitation needs. Position Summary: An experienced registered nurse with the Knowledge and Skills to coordinate and oversee all functions of the MDS and resident care assessment process to assure compliance with federal and state requirements, and to certify timely completion of MDS assessments. Able to collect resident assessment data in person and electronically. Able to care plan appropriate resident needs
